Product Description The Crest Audio 7301 is a two rack space, compact power amplifier specifically designed for use in bi-amplified systems, including stage monitor, studio monitor and front-of-house applications. The low frequency channel (Ch. A) utilizes class H operation, which increases efficiency and yields higher output power on the low end. The high frequency channel (Ch. B) utilizes class AB operation which is optimized for precise reproduction of mid and high-frequency signals. For bi-amped systems, the Crest Audio 7301 is unmatched in quality, efficiency and sonic accuracy. When used in combination with a crossover (including those available in the Crest Audio Octal Socket Accessory line), the 7301 becomes a complete bi-amplification system, in a space-efficient package. The 7301 is fully compatible in design with the other Crest Audio Professional Series amplifiers, Octal Socket Accessories, and the NexSys® computer controlled audio system. Design and Construction The no-compromise approach in the 7301’s electrical design and mechanical construction provides the ultimate in reliability and performance. Only high-grade components are used for the modular sub-assemblies in this ultra-strong, steel single piece chassis.
7301 Features • Crest Audio’s legendary “overbuilt” power supply • Toroidal power transformer • Latest generation of high-speed, wide-bandwidth output devices • Tunnel cooling with back-to-front air flow • Dual, variable speed DC fans • High thermal mass heat sinks • Balanced XLR inputs • 5-way output binding post connectors • Rear panel ground lift jumper • 7301 protection circuitry: - Clip Limiting prevents speaker damage with gentle gain reduction at clip threshold. - IGM (Instantaneous Gain Modulation) monitors connected loads to detect conditions that may overstress output devices, allowing safe operation into nominal 2Ω impedances. - AutoRamp gradually increases gain to attenuator setting level when amplifier is turned on. - Other protection circuitry: comprehensive thermal management, and short circuit, DC voltage, turn-on/off transient, current inrush and sub/ultrasonic input protection. • Recessed, stepped attenuators • Front panel circuit breaker/power switch • Modular construction
